Feast of Argentine Tango and Folklore Vol.3

Un Mismo Cielo - Weaving Time, Bonds in the Sky

2025/07/17(Th.) 18:30 Starting

Shibuya Ward Cultural Center Owada Sakura HallTokyo

Official https://international-culture.co.jp/e/250717/

This is the third installment with Daniel Urquisha, a dancer/choreographer/director who has inherited a deep and rich tradition and sublimated it into a one-of-a-kind expression by fusing it with modern sensibilities.
A new world of art that transcends genres and borders will be spun out.

Free for children 18 and under, half-price for one accompanying person.
Through the 2025 Agency for Cultural Affairs' project to support children's appreciation of performing arts in theaters and music halls, the first 50 pairs of children under 18 years old will be invited free of charge, and one accompanying parent or guardian will receive a half-price ticket.

Music and Dance Journey to Argentina and Japan for Parents and Children
Argentina, South America, and Japan.
Different cultures resonate with each other to create a work of art that is unique to the here and now.

An original stage production by dancer/choreographer/director Daniel Urquiza.
The worlds of tango and folklore will be beautifully fused together with Japanese performers.

Powerful live performance by piano, three violins, bandoneon, and double bass.
The "bombo," a drum that makes you feel the earth of Argentina, and the powerful and delicate tango and folklore dance.
A heart-stirring time of music and physical expression awaits you.
